Perkenalan
Integrasi antara JavaScript dan API eksternal menjadi hal yang semakin penting dalam pengembangan web modern. API (Application Programming Interface) menyediakan cara bagi aplikasi web untuk berkomunikasi dengan layanan eksternal dan mendapatkan data atau fungsionalitas tambahan. Menggunakan JavaScript untuk mengintegrasikan API eksternal memungkinkan pengembang untuk membuat aplikasi web yang dinamis, responsif, dan kaya akan fitur. Dalam artikel ini, kita akan menjelajahi beberapa tips penting untuk mengintegrasikan JavaScript dengan API eksternal secara efektif.
Memahami Konsep Dasar JavaScript dan API
Sebelum melangkah lebih jauh, penting untuk memiliki pemahaman yang kuat tentang konsep dasar JavaScript dan API. JavaScript adalah bahasa pemrograman yang umum digunakan untuk membuat aplikasi web interaktif. API, di sisi lain, adalah kumpulan instruksi dan standar yang digunakan oleh program perangkat lunak untuk berkomunikasi satu sama lain. Dengan memahami kedua konsep ini, pengembang dapat menggabungkan kekuatan JavaScript dengan data dan fungsionalitas yang disediakan oleh API eksternal.
Menggunakan Teknik Asynchronous untuk Mengambil Data dari API
Salah satu aspek penting dalam mengintegrasikan JavaScript dengan API eksternal adalah pengambilan data secara asynchronous. Ini memungkinkan aplikasi web untuk tetap responsif sambil menunggu respon dari API. Dengan menggunakan teknik seperti XML Http Request atau fetch API, pengembang dapat membuat permintaan HTTP ke API dan menangani responsnya secara efektif tanpa menghalangi eksekusi kode JavaScript lainnya. Ini memastikan pengalaman pengguna yang mulus dan cepat.
Menangani Respons API dengan Bijaksana
Saat mengintegrasikan JavaScript dengan API eksternal, penting untuk menangani respons API dengan bijaksana. Ini termasuk memvalidasi dan memproses data yang diterima dari API sesuai kebutuhan aplikasi Anda. Menggunakan metode seperti JSON.parse() untuk menguraikan respons JSON dari API dan menangani kesalahan dengan baik adalah praktik terbaik yang harus diikuti. Dengan menangani respons API dengan bijaksana, Anda dapat memastikan keandalan dan stabilitas aplikasi Anda.
Kunjungi halaman ini untuk menemukan artikel terkait Validasi dengan JavaScript .
Memperhatikan Keamanan
Keamanan merupakan aspek penting lainnya dalam mengintegrasikan JavaScript dengan API eksternal. Penting untuk menghindari kerentanan keamanan seperti serangan XSS (Cross-Site Scripting) atau CSRF (Cross-Site Request Forgery). Penggunaan HTTPS untuk berkomunikasi dengan API, validasi input pengguna, dan sanitasi data sebelum menampilkannya di aplikasi adalah langkah-langkah yang dapat membantu menjaga keamanan aplikasi Anda. Selain itu, memastikan bahwa API yang digunakan telah diotorisasi dan menggunakan mekanisme otentikasi yang tepat juga penting untuk mencegah akses yang tidak sah.
Kesimpulan
Integrasi JavaScript dengan API eksternal membuka pintu untuk pembuatan aplikasi web yang dinamis dan kuat. Dengan memahami konsep dasar JavaScript dan API, menggunakan teknik asynchronous untuk mengambil data, menangani respons API dengan bijaksana, dan memperhatikan keamanan, pengembang dapat menciptakan aplikasi web yang responsif, aman, dan kaya akan fitur. Dengan mengikuti tips yang disebutkan di atas, Anda dapat mengoptimalkan proses integrasi JavaScript dengan API eksternal dan meningkatkan kualitas aplikasi web Anda secara keseluruhan.